Understanding the Appeal of Classic Slots
Classic slots hold a unique place in the history of casino gaming, evoking a sense of nostalgia and simplicity that continues to attract players of all ages. Unlike their more complex video slot counterparts, classic slots typically feature three reels and a limited number of paylines, making them easy to understand and play. This straightforward format appeals to those who appreciate a less overwhelming gaming experience, focusing on the core excitement of spinning the reels and hoping for a winning combination. The iconic symbols – cherries, lemons, bells, and lucky sevens – further contribute to the charm and recognizability of these timeless games. The enduring popularity of classic slots is a testament to their enduring appeal, proving that sometimes, less really is more.
The Evolution of Slot Game Technology
While the fundamental principles of classic slots have remained largely unchanged, the technology behind them has undergone a dramatic transformation. Early mechanical slots relied on intricate systems of gears and levers to determine the outcome of each spin. These machines were prone to mechanical failures and offered limited customization options. The advent of computerization revolutionized the slot gaming experience, allowing for the introduction of random number generators (RNGs) to ensure fair and unbiased results. Modern slots utilize sophisticated software and algorithms to create visually stunning graphics, immersive sound effects, and a wide range of bonus features. This evolution has not only enhanced the entertainment value of slot games but has also made them more secure and reliable.

Navigating Bonus Offers and Promotions
Bonus offers and promotions are a cornerstone of the online casino industry, designed to attract new players and reward existing ones. These incentives can take various forms, including wel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ty programs. While bonus offers can significantly enhance the gaming experience, it’s crucial to understand the terms and conditions associated with them. Wagering requirements, also known as playthrough requirements, specify the amount of money a player must bet before they can withdraw any winnings generated from the bonus. Other restrictions may apply, such as limits on the games that can be played or the maximum amount that can be won. Careful consideration of these factors is essential to ensure that the bonus offer is truly worthwhile.
Understanding Wagering Requirements
Wagering requirements are arguably the most important aspect of any online casino bonus. They dictate the number of times a player must wager the bonus amount (and sometimes the deposit amount as well) before they can access their winnings.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means that a player must bet 30 times the bonus amount before they can withdraw any associated winnings. Lower wagering requirements are generally more favorable, as they make it easier to clear the bonus and access your funds. It's also important to check the percentage contribution of different games towards the wagering requirement. Some games, such as slots, may contribute 100%, while others, like blackjack or roulette, may contribute a smaller percentage.

Responsible Gaming and Player Protection
The online casino industry has a responsibility to promote responsible gaming and protect vulnerable players. Reputable casino operators implement a range of measures to ensure that their platforms are used safely and responsibly. These measures include age verification processes, self-exclusion programs, deposit limits, and responsible gambling guides. Age verification is essential to prevent underage gambling, while self-exclusion programs allow players to voluntarily ban themselves from accessing the casino’s services. Deposit limits help players control their spending, while responsible gambling guides provide information on recognizing and addressing problem gambling behaviors. By prioritizing player protection, online casinos can create a safer and more sustainable gaming environment.
It is also the player's responsibility to practice safe and responsible gaming habits. Set realistic budgets, avoid chasing losses, and take regular breaks from gaming. Be aware of the warning signs of problem gambling, such as spending more money than you can afford, neglecting personal responsibilities, or feeling anxious or irritable when not gambling. If you or someone you know is struggling with problem gambling, seek help from a reputable organization specializing in gambling addiction.
